Putting It Into Action: A Practical Example
Here's how you could apply bankroll management rules:
Total Bankroll: $1,000
Session Bankroll: You divide your total bankroll by the number of planned sessions. If you lose it, your session is over. Bet Sizing: With a $250 session bankroll, you should aim for bets in the $2.50 to $5 range (1-2%). This allows for 50-100 bets, which is a reasonable amount of playtim $1,000 / 4 = $250 per session. Stop-Loss Limit: Your stop-loss for the session is the full $250.

Not a single betting system can alter the underlying probabilistic probabilities of a casino (8.137.56.84) game. The Sobering Truth: The House Advantage
It's crucial to face the reality of how casinos work: betting systems, while methodical, cannot overcome the inherent house edge in the long run. The house advantage—the inherent statistical advantage the casino has in every game—will invariably prevail over the long ter
